What is Aircall?

Aircall is a cloud-based phone system that integrates with popular CRMs and Helpdesk tools, that aims to help sales and support teams with 3+ users communicate clearly and efficiently. Admins can add numbers from 100+ countries, scale their teams according to seasonality, and gain insights through real-time analytics. Accessible by desktop and mobile app, Aircall boasts users at over 7000 companies worldwide.

Aircall headquartered in Paris provides a VOIP system for business designed to support contact centers, featuring IVR and automated call routing, conference calls, shared call inbox and call notes, unlimited concurrent calls and call queuing, and many integrations with CRM or marketing systems to support a variety of support or sales purposes.

RingEX, Dialpad Ai Contact Center, and Five9 are common alternatives for Aircall.

Reviewers rate Directory of employee names highest, with a score of 9.9.

The most common users of Aircall are from Mid-sized Companies (51-1,000 employees).

Our customer service team - which I am a part of - is using Aircall to answer any of our (potential) customer enquiries: advice prior to subscription, management of their contract, management of their claim if applicable, etc...
  • Technical support and account management are very responsive
  • Easy set-up of numbers
  • Extensive knowledge base available
  • The rules to get a phone number abroad are flexible enough for a company with multi-country reach
  • No schedule for bank holidays
  • No feature to update more than one phone line at the same time
  • Admins don't have access to the timeline of a call to see with which agent it rang
  • Missing agent-specific stats when your phone lines are organized in teams
  • If calls are setup to ring to a first group and then a second, if the whole first group is already busy, it does not go to the second group but puts the customer on hold
Aircall in its current form is well suited if you do not have a lot of phone numbers, but if you expand too much and need to constantly add phone numbers, it becomes cumbersome to manage all phone lines (see cons mentioned)

We Are Traction is a 100% remote organisation with staff spread across the globe; Indonesia, India, South Africa, Portugal, UK, Channel Islands, Brazil & the USA. It is mainly used by the marketing and sales department to contact prospective clients anywhere in the world, but mainly in the UK, USA and South Africa.
  • Ability to easily transfer between consultants
  • Call recording (Cloud)
  • Simplicity and ease of use
  • Intuitive UX lacking
  • "Lag" experienced when dialing countries to do not have local host servers
  • Not able to connect. This also happens very often when dialing countries that does not have local servers
Aircall is easy to use and the UI does not use a lot of resources. It is ideal for a remotely spread workforce, with the ability to transfer calls between consultants on different continents. However, be carefull when you use it to dial countries that does not have locally hosted Aircall servers or partnerships with local telecoms service providers.
